Video: Raffi Hovannisian Not Allowed to Enter Memorial Complex, Lays Flowers on Asphalt
The first Foreign Minister of Armenia, Raffi Hovannisian, was denied access to the Sardarapat Memorial Complex by police and special forces, as a solemn ceremony attended by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an and other high-ranking officials was taking place, 24news.am reports.
Hovannisian laid the flowers he brought directly on the road instead.
It is worth noting that May 28 is the Day of the First Republic of Armenia. On May 28, 1918, following the collapse of the Democratic Federal Republic of Transcaucasia in Tbilisi, the Armenian Republic was declared by the 'Armenian National Council'.
